Get Involved:
Our Community is only as successful as we make it. By getting involved, you can make a real difference in the community.  Whether you are up for a big a commitment like serving on the Board, or a something less time consuming like joining one of our committees, your involvement can make a difference.  It can be as simple as attending a meeting. 

Our HOA is homeowner controlled and has the mission of serving the homeowners and maintaining their property values. With such a large community, your ideas, input and other contributions are not only welcomed, but needed. All of the HOA meetings are open to the community and we strongly encourage homeowners to come.  If you would like to join one of the neighborhood committees, please contact the appropriate committee chair or fill out the Join Committee Form.

PDL Committees
​
Architecture & Landscape
​Committee Chair
tba

Mission/Purpose:
The purpose of the Architecture and Landscape Committee is to preserve, enhance and assure uniformity in the architectural aesthetics of the community by consistently applying and upholding the rules and regulations set forth in our governing documents (Covenants) for landscape and architecture improvements to homes within the Association. Also to maintain and improve, when needed, the grass, trees, plants, flowers and grounds located in the common areas; and oversee the seasonal maintenance activities.
Social 
​Committee Chair
Tiffany Taylor

Mission/Purpose:

To create a community environment where neighbors can share and participate in community events that cultivate fellowship and get people connected to each other, which will enhance the living and social environment of the Community.

Pool
Committee Chair
tba
​
Mission/Purpose:
To maintain safety by enforcing pool rules and making sure that it is staffed with security, and to make sure that the pool is enjoyable to all homeowners and visitors.

​
Recreation
Committee Chair
tba

Mission/Purpose:
To establish fun recreation activities within our community for children of all abilities that encourage physical fitness and development, social interaction, cognitive growth and imaginative play.​​
neighborhood watch
​Committee Chair
tba

Mission/Purpose:
The purpose of our Neighborhood Watch Organization is to help protect our resident's property and maintain the safety and security of our neighborhoos.  In partnership with the Fairburn Police Department, learn how to make our homes safe and prevent crime in our community by having a visible presence, being observant and reporting suspicious activities to the local authority.  The committee will also keep the residents informed of issues and come up with strategies to keep the neighborhood safe.
men of purpose
Committee Chair
​Arthur Cabell

​Mission/Purpose
:
To assist other committees with their projects, to assist the community with various projects and to assist with upgrades of structures around the community. Organize adult events for the community.
